Yes, the vertices and indices will be extracted, yet all they do is allow you to do the step where you right click, select add, select the model for importing, etc. Without them it'll say that it can't find the indices/vertices, etc. Then, in that step, you go to the folder where the vertices file, the indices file, and the sbsp or bsp (I forget which one) were extracted to earlier in the tutorial, and fill the blanks where you need to with the correct file. That will then create the new.vertices, new.indices, and sbsp.meta files.

Alaysian, what you're having troubles with is something that everyone has. The box is always going to be there, no matter what. For scenery, just swap a piece of scenery in the map for your new piece of scenery, and even though it's viewed as a yellow box in SE, it will show up in-game.
However, for vehicles, you'll need to do a meta swap in HMT. Not neccessarily with a piece of scenery, but you can do a vehicle too. Although if you import some unneccessary models and pieces of scenery that correspond with them, you can just overwrite those ones, and not have to replace any needed scenery/vehicles.
The odd thing is, on my first and second model import, the models actually would show up in Sparkedit... but, like you now, I get boxes... x.x If only I could remember what I did..
And as for the elites on the sides of the tanks, I can't help you there... make sure "Uses MC weapons" is selected, but other than that, I can't help you there..
